免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
查看: 2196 | 回复: 7
打印 上一主题 下一主题

[SCO UNIX] 请教高人:可以将advfs文件系统中的文件直接倒入裸设备文件吗? [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2003-07-10 13:45 |只看该作者 |倒序浏览
在一个双机并行环境中,有某个笨蛋将oracle 数据库的数据文件建在了系统盘上(在一个表空间里增加数据文件)。
    如果都是普通文件系统的文件,可以直接COPY 或 MOVE,然后在数据库中移动数据文件,但是现在是一个 advfs 文件系统的文件要 COPY 或 MOVE 到裸设备文件中/dev/rdrd/drd** ,有解决办法吗?

论坛徽章:
0
2 [报告]
发表于 2003-07-11 15:56 |只看该作者

请教高人:可以将advfs文件系统中的文件直接倒入裸设备文件吗?

没有办法可以实现吗?
     大虾们,帮我想想办法好不好?

论坛徽章:
0
3 [报告]
发表于 2003-07-14 13:24 |只看该作者

请教高人:可以将advfs文件系统中的文件直接倒入裸设备文件吗?

feel so cool.

论坛徽章:
0
4 [报告]
发表于 2003-07-16 16:58 |只看该作者

请教高人:可以将advfs文件系统中的文件直接倒入裸设备文件吗?

你的ORACLE在安装时就已经设置了使用文件系统作为datafile了,如果你直接将文件系统里面的文件dd到裸设备上也是没用的,
你可以把你的ORACLE数据库export出来,然后在drd建表空间,把ORACLE的表空间改名,然后再import数据库。

论坛徽章:
0
5 [报告]
发表于 2003-07-17 10:50 |只看该作者

请教高人:可以将advfs文件系统中的文件直接倒入裸设备文件吗?

原帖由 "pcpcpc888" 发表:
你的ORACLE在安装时就已经设置了使用文件系统作为datafile了,如果你直接将文件系统里面的文件dd到裸设备上也是没用的,
你可以把你的ORACLE数据库export出来,然后在drd建表空间,把ORACLE的表空间改名,然后再imp..........
   

情况和你想象的不太一样,我的ORACLE在安装时所有datafile 都是用的裸设备,后来是一个非系统管理员觉得自己的表空间不够用,在一个表空间下增加了一个数据文件——但是他以前只用过单机系统,增加的数据文件放在了其中一台主机的系统盘上,只有这一个datafile 是文件系统的,结果是连接到另一台主机的用户无法访问和操作此datafile 中的内容。
你说的办法的确是可行的,但是要将20G数据导出,修改数据文件和表空间,再导入回去,不但需要较长的停机时间,还容易在导出导入过程中发生问题。
ORACLE 数据库可以在操作系统下移动数据文件,然后重定位数据文件(move or rename)就可以轻松地解决以上问题。听一位工程师说用dd 将advfs 文件倒入裸设备是可行的,但不同操作系统需要修正不同的偏移值(Tru64 UNIX 他不清楚),其中HP-UX是不需要修正的,不知有没有高手知道Tru64 UNIX的这个秘密?

论坛徽章:
0
6 [报告]
发表于 2003-07-17 11:55 |只看该作者

请教高人:可以将advfs文件系统中的文件直接倒入裸设备文件吗?

你那个数据文件所在的数据库表空间大吗?如果不大的话,建议导出数据,删除表空间,再删除那个数据文件,重建表空间,导入数据。

论坛徽章:
0
7 [报告]
发表于 2003-07-17 22:51 |只看该作者

请教高人:可以将advfs文件系统中的文件直接倒入裸设备文件吗?

add the raw device as new tablespace, find all objects in the file system tablespace.
alter table ... move tablespace ...;
alter index .. rebuild tablespace ...;
...

论坛徽章:
0
8 [报告]
发表于 2003-08-25 17:05 |只看该作者

请教高人:可以将advfs文件系统中的文件直接倒入裸设备文件吗?

当然可以,通过dd命令,拷贝时跳过raw设备的前64k的位置,然后在数据库中改名就可以了
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P